1. Vietnam
Vietnam is a paradise for travelers seeking a mix of history, culture, and stunning landscapes at low cost. From the bustling streets of Hanoi to the serene waters of Ha Long Bay, you can explore vibrant markets, savor authentic street food, and take affordable boat tours. Local accommodations, transportation, and meals are remarkably cheap, making Vietnam ideal for extended stays.
2. Portugal
Portugal remains one of Europe’s most budget-friendly destinations. Explore Lisbon’s colorful streets, Porto’s wine cellars, or the Algarve’s pristine beaches without overspending. Public transportation is reliable and inexpensive, and you’ll find a variety of affordable guesthouses and hostels. Don’t forget to indulge in local pastries like the iconic Pastel de Nata — a treat for both your taste buds and your wallet.
3. Mexico

Beyond the famous resorts, Mexico has countless affordable options for travelers seeking culture and adventure. Explore colonial towns like Guanajuato, vibrant markets in Oaxaca, or pristine beaches on the Yucatán Peninsula. Street food is delicious and inexpensive, and bus travel between cities is both efficient and cheap.
4. Greece
While Santorini and Mykonos can be pricey, Greece offers many affordable alternatives. Crete, Naxos, and smaller islands provide incredible beaches, historic ruins, and authentic local experiences at lower costs. Guesthouses and family-run tavernas offer quality accommodations and meals that won’t break the bank. Off-season travel further reduces expenses while avoiding the crowds.
5. Morocco
Morocco offers a sensory overload of colors, flavors, and textures — all at affordable prices. Wander through the bustling souks of Marrakech, explore the ancient streets of Fes, or hike in the Atlas Mountains. Street food, local markets, and budget-friendly riads make Morocco a top destination for travelers seeking adventure and culture without overspending.
6. Indonesia
Indonesia isn’t just Bali. Explore Lombok, Yogyakarta, or the remote Gili Islands for breathtaking landscapes and rich culture. Affordable local transportation, inexpensive street food, and budget-friendly accommodations allow you to travel extensively without spending a fortune. Surfing, snorkeling, and hiking are also widely accessible for budget travelers.
7. Hungary
Hungary, particularly Budapest, combines history, architecture, and a vibrant nightlife at low cost. Thermal baths, historic castles, and riverside promenades provide plenty of entertainment without requiring a luxury budget. Public transportation is efficient and cheap, and local eateries offer delicious meals at a fraction of Western Europe’s prices.
8. Thailand

Thailand remains a staple for budget travelers. From bustling Bangkok to serene Chiang Mai and the tropical islands of the south, Thailand offers affordable accommodations, street food, and cultural experiences. Markets, temples, and beaches can all be explored on a tight budget, and local tours are accessible without overspending.
9. Bulgaria
Bulgaria is a hidden gem in Eastern Europe with stunning beaches, mountain ranges, and charming towns. The cost of living is low, making accommodations, food, and transportation very affordable. Sofia and Plovdiv offer rich cultural experiences, while the Black Sea coast provides budget-friendly seaside escapes.
10. Sri Lanka
Sri Lanka offers incredible natural beauty, wildlife, and history for budget-conscious travelers. Explore tea plantations, national parks, and ancient ruins without expensive tours. Local trains provide scenic routes at minimal cost, and street food offers a flavorful, inexpensive way to experience authentic Sri Lankan cuisine.
Travel Tips to Keep Costs Low in 2025
- Book in advance: Flights and accommodations are cheaper when booked early.
- Travel off-season: Avoid peak months for lower prices and fewer crowds.
- Use local transportation: Buses, trains, and ferries are cost-effective alternatives to taxis.
- Eat local: Street food and small family-run eateries are delicious and budget-friendly.
- Stay flexible: Being open to alternate destinations, accommodations, or travel dates can save a lot.
